David was overwhelmed by those pursuing and hid in a cave.

When I am overwhelmed, You alone know the way I should turn. Psalm 142:3

I cried unto Thee , O LORD: I said, Thou art my refuge (shelter, hope, trust) and my portion (smoothness, allotment) in the land of the living.  (Ps. 142:5)

I stretch forth my hands unto Thee: my soul thirsteth after Thee, as a thirsty land. (Ps. 143:6)

Teach me to do Thy will; for Thou art my God: Thy Spirit is good; lead me into the land of uprightness (along the land of smoothness). (Ps. 143:10)

Andrew Bonar said it this way about the last verse:
The land of plainness, a land where no wickedness of men, and malice of Satan, vex the soul day to day; a land where no rough paths and crooked turns lengthen out the traveler's weary journey; but where all is like the smooth pasture-land of Reuben (Deut. 3:16-20), a fit place for a flocks to lie down.

LET IT GROW

My goodness, and my fortress; my high tower, and my deliverer; my shield, and He in whom I trust; who subdueth my people under me. (Ps. 144:2)

Happy is that people whose God is the LORD. (verse 15)

When we are in need of a fortress, a high tower of protection; in need of a deliverer, and a shield against the evils of this world, trust in God. He will be with us through whatever enemy we are combating today. Then as we make God our LORD, we will happily endure and survive. It is for His glory and our good.


So I say, it is good to be in the land of the living and the land of the uprightness, no matter the battles we are facing. Our God is with us and is our happiness when we turn to Him.
